Aluminum's initial two electrons drop during the 1s orbital, and the next two electrons go in the 2s orbital. The next six electrons fill the 2p orbital in the 2nd shell (which is ten electrons to this point, 3 more to go). Then electrons eleven and 12 fill the 3s orbital. Lastly the last electron occupies the 3p orbital.

This behaviour of Al(OH)3 is termed amphoterism, and is also attribute of weakly primary cations that sort insoluble hydroxides and whose hydrated species could also donate their protons. Further more examples include things like Be2+, Zn2+, Ga3+, Sn2+, and Pb2+; indeed, gallium in the same group is a bit additional acidic than aluminium. A person effect of this is the fact that aluminium salts with weak acids are hydrolysed in water for the aquated hydroxide along with the corresponding nonmetal hydride: aluminium sulfide yields hydrogen sulfide, aluminium nitride yields ammonia, and aluminium carbide yields methane.

Pure aluminium is made from bauxite, a sort of rock which includes aluminium oxide and a lot of impurities. The bauxite is crushed and reacted with sodium hydroxide. The aluminium oxide dissolves. Then the aluminium oxide is dissolved in liquid cryolite.
